WebMar 2, 2024 · If you are immune to being frightened, an effect that merely frightens you is ended. If someone tries to apply it, you are immune. It isn't suppressed. An effect that frightens you and also does something else isn't ended. The Bardic Countercharm ability grants advantage on saves against charmed and frightened effects. Heroes Fest also gives advantage on all wisdom saves, which include charm effects.
